Frequently Asked Questions
How long do these ceramic brake pads last for daily driving?
Pad lifespan varies with driving habits but expect typical daily-driving ceramic pads to last roughly the same or a bit longer than OEM pads under normal commuting use. Aggressive driving, frequent heavy braking, or towing will shorten life. Inspect pads at regular service intervals and replace when thickness nears the manufacturer’s minimum recommendation.
Will cross-drilled or slotted rotors make more noise?
Cross-drilled and slotted rotors are designed for better heat dissipation and can actually improve braking consistency. They don’t inherently cause noise, but any rotor can produce squeal during bedding-in or if pads/shims aren’t seated correctly. Choose kits with rubberized shims or follow a proper bedding procedure to reduce the chance of squeal.
Do these kits include everything needed for a DIY install?
Yes — the reviewed kits include rotors, pads, and the specified installation hardware for the rear axle. They are direct bolt-on replacements for the listed models. Still, confirm fitment for your exact model year before purchase and have tools, jack stands, and a torque wrench when doing a DIY swap.
